C92.7 is the ICD-10 code for Other myeloid leukaemia. It is a four-character subcategory of C92 (Myeloid leukaemia), the most specific level in the WHO edition. It belongs to the block C81–C96 (Malignant neoplasms, stated or presumed to be primary, of lymphoid, haematopoietic and related tissue) in Chapter II, Neoplasms.

What C92.7 excludes

Conditions that look similar but belong under another code.

  • chronic eosinophilic leukaemia [hypereosinophilic syndrome] D47.5
